ADHD Empowerment: Mindful Strategies for Executive Function

Available to clients in New York

This 11-week group will teach 28 tangible mindfulness and executive functioning techniques that will help individuals with ADHD better function in their everyday lives. After completing the group, participants will have learned techniques that will help with time management, effective task completion and organizational skills. This group includes content from the Mindful Awareness Program (MAPs) for ADHD, an evidence-based practice.

DBT Skills Group

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T) Skills Group is a pivotal part of DBT that works together with individual therapy to help participants cope with intense emotions & build a life they want to show up for.

This group is a year long commitment that focuses on learning & applying 75 DBT Skills that help people manage stress, increase moments of calm & strengthen interpersonal relationships.
